The graph beneath reveals the productiveness, measured in time to complete every project, for each groups. The college students that worked alone had been quicker (~15%)to complete every assignment than the pair, however not by a whole lot. Also notice, that the productivity of the pair improved over time presumably as a outcome of time it takes for 2 folks to work together.

In pair programming, one individual is the “driver,” and the opposite is the “navigator.” The driver is the person on the keyboard who’s actively writing code. According to UNESCO’s report (2020), numerous nations and regions experienced the disruption of studying in any respect ranges of schooling due to the COVID-19 pandemic. To adapt to the pandemic, many faculties and universities quickly transitioned from conventional face-to-face or blended instruction to fully online studying solutions, named emergency distant educating (Hodges et al., 2020). Researchers have argued that a possible affect of the COVID-19 crisis was making educators embrace using new applied sciences and promote educational innovations (Thomas & Rogers, 2020). Thus, academic institutions are inclined to rethink instructional normalcy and develop learning methods and approaches that are more delicate to learners’ wants in the post-pandemic period (Cahapay, 2020). The variety of major studies retrieved in these associated studies diversified from 18 to 74, as different information sources and the search strategies had been used. The meta-analysis conducted by Hannay et al. (2009) retrieved 18 main studies printed from 1998 to 2007. The systematic critiques by Salleh et al. (2010) and Da Silva Estácio and Prikladnicki (2015) included articles printed respectively from 1999 to 2007 and from 2001 to 2013. Umapathy and Ritzhaupt’s (2017) meta-analysis covers extra updated studies printed before 2014. Considering the numerous improvement of DPP in current years, it is essential to systematically aggregate and analyze extra empirical research revealed in the last decade. The fourth analysis query aimed to analyze the extent to which heterogeneous and homogeneous pairs would differ of their adherence to pair programming pointers. We hypothesized that homogeneous pairs would change roles extra regularly than heterogeneous pairs. Further we hypothesized that the entire number of interventions by the navigator and the sum of the average intervention durations by the learners in a pair can be larger amongst heterogeneous pairs than homogeneous pairs. The outcomes of this research present that homogeneous pairs did not switch roles extra regularly than heterogeneous pairs. Regarding the whole number of interventions by the navigator, learners in homogeneous male pairs in Grades 7–9 intervened more regularly.

Moravec’s paradox, first described in 1988, states that what’s simple for people is hard for machines, and what humans discover difficult is usually simpler for computers. Many pc methods can carry out complicated mathematical operations, for instance, however good luck asking most robots to fold laundry or twist doorknobs. When it turned obvious that machines would continue to battle to effectively manipulate objects, widespread definitions of AGI lost their connections with the bodily world, Mitchell notes. AGI came to symbolize mastery of cognitive duties and then what a human might do sitting at a computer linked to the Internet. Essentially, ChatGPT is an online chatbot primarily based on a question-answering system [2, 3]. The suffix “GPT” means generative pre-trained transformer [4] that could be a sort of huge language model (LLM) consisting of billions of parameters skilled by way of switch learning [5]. Since its introduction in November 2022, ChatGPT has generated vital consideration, resulting in the publication of many articles addressing its influence on analysis and training as properly as raising ethical issues [6,7,8,9,10,11]. Additionally, there are research discussing potentialities for ChatGPT to reach synthetic common intelligence (AGI) [12, 13]. The symbolic strategy assumes that laptop techniques can develop AGI by representing human thoughts with increasing logic networks. The logic network symbolizes physical objects with an if-else logic, allowing the AI system to interpret ideas at a higher pondering stage.
